/* Code tidied up by ScrapBook */
.no_bg { background: transparent none repeat scroll 0% 0% ! important; z-index: 2147483647; }
#window { width: 100%; height: 100%; position: fixed; top: 0px; left: 0px; background: transparent url("heibg.png") repeat scroll left top; display: none; z-index: 2147483647; }
#float_window { position: absolute; top: 50%; left: 50%; padding: 0px; z-index: 20001; }
#float_window .closewindow { width: 52px; background: transparent url("btn_close.png") no-repeat scroll left bottom; height: 52px; position: absolute; margin-top: 155px; margin-left: -70px; cursor: pointer; }
#float_window .closewindow:hover { background-position: left top; }
#windows { width: 100%; height: 100%; position: fixed; top: 200px; left: 0px; background: transparent url("heibg.png") repeat scroll left top; display: none; z-index: 2147483647; }
#float_windows { position: absolute; top: 50%; left: 50%; padding: 0px; z-index: 20001; }
#float_windows .closewindows { width: 52px; background: transparent url("btn_close.png") no-repeat scroll left bottom; height: 52px; position: absolute; margin-top: 0px; margin-left: -1050px; cursor: pointer; }
#float_windows .closewindows:hover { background-position: left top; }
.container1 { width: 467px; height: auto; margin-left: 7px; }
.container1 .div_scroll { float: left; width: 100%; height: 50px; overflow: auto; }
.container1 .scroll_container { position: relative; overflow: hidden; }
.container1 .scroll_absolute { position: absolute; }
.container1 .scroll_vertical_bar { width: 10px; height: 100%; position: absolute; top: 0px; right: 0px; margin: 0px; padding: 0px; }
.container1 .scroll_track { position: relative; border-radius: 10px; background: transparent url("line_y.gif") repeat-y scroll center top; }
.container1 .scroll_drag { position: relative; top: 0px; left: 0px; border-top: medium none; border-bottom: medium none; cursor: pointer; background-color: rgb(112, 7, 7); border-radius: 20px; }
.container1 .scroll_arrow { text-indent: -20000px; cursor: pointer; display: block; }
.container1 .scroll_vertical_bar .scroll_arrow { height: 16px; }
#DocContent2 { width: 1000px; height: 750px; background: transparent url("nobg.png") no-repeat scroll 0% 0%; padding-top: 240px; padding-left: 30px; font-family: "Microsoft YaHei" ! important; font-size: 14px; z-index: 2147483647; }
#DocContent2 .Left { float: left; width: 280px; height: 360px; margin-left: 120px; }
#DocContent2 .kefu { float: left; width: 280px; color: rgb(255, 255, 255); margin-top: 30px; }
#DocContent2 .kefu li { float: left; width: 280px; height: 24px; line-height: 24px; display: block; margin-bottom: 10px; }
#DocContent2 .kefu li span { float: left; width: 22px; height: 22px; background: transparent url("icon_qq.png") no-repeat scroll center top; margin-right: 10px; }
#DocContent2 .kefu li dt { float: left; width: 22px; height: 22px; background: transparent url("icon_qq.png") no-repeat scroll center top; margin-right: 10px; }
#DocContent2 .kefu li a { color: rgb(206, 195, 172); }
#DocContent2 .kefu li a:hover { color: rgb(211, 116, 14); }
#DocContent2 .Right { float: right; width: 420px; height: 360px; margin-right: 160px; }
#DocContent2 .down { float: left; width: 400px; color: rgb(255, 255, 255); margin-top: 30px; }
#DocContent2 .down a { float: left; width: 400px; height: 45px; line-height: 45px; color: rgb(206, 195, 172); display: block; margin-bottom: 10px; background: transparent url("downbg.png") no-repeat scroll center top; text-align: center; }
#DocContent2 .down a:hover { color: rgb(255, 255, 255); background: transparent url("downbghover.png") no-repeat scroll center top; }
#DocContent2 .hot_news { float: left; width: 430px; padding: 10px; height: 25px; line-height: 25px; font-size: 16px; font-weight: 700; margin-bottom: 13px; border-bottom: 1px solid rgb(66, 53, 50); margin-left: 20px; overflow: hidden; text-align: center; }
#DocContent2 .hot_news a { font-size: 16px; color: rgb(171, 131, 36); }
#DocContent2 .hot_news span { padding: 0px 7px; color: rgb(255, 255, 255); margin-right: 12px; background-color: rgb(197, 25, 15); display: inline-block; }
#DocContent2 .content2 { line-height: 28px; width: 470px; height: auto; padding: 0px 10px; color: rgb(255, 255, 255); text-shadow: 1px 1px 0px rgb(0, 0, 0); font-family: "Microsoft YaHei"; font-weight: 400; }
#DocContent2 .content2 p { float: left; text-indent: 24px; font-size: 14px; width: 460px; overflow: hidden; }
#DocContent2 .container1 { width: 490px; height: auto; margin: 20px auto 0px; }
#DocContent2 .container1 .div_scroll { float: left; width: 100%; height: 200px; overflow: auto; padding-right: 10px; }
#DocContent2 .tanvideo { float: left; width: 440px; height: 350px; margin-left: 290px; margin-top: 8px; }
#contact { float: left; width: 380px; height: 370px; overflow: hidden; }
#contact .erweimabox { float: left; width: 180px; height: 180px; margin-left: 70px; padding: 15px; display: block; border: 1px solid rgb(244, 122, 14); }
#contact .erweimabox img { width: 180px; height: 180px; }
#contact .kefu { float: left; width: 380px; color: rgb(255, 255, 255); margin-top: 20px; margin-left: 60px; }
#contact .kefu li { float: left; width: 380px; height: 24px; line-height: 24px; display: block; margin-bottom: 10px; }
#contact .kefu li span { float: left; width: 22px; height: 22px; background: transparent url("icon_qq.png") no-repeat scroll center top; margin-right: 10px; }
#contact .kefu li a { color: rgb(206, 195, 172); }
#contact .kefu li a:hover { color: rgb(211, 116, 14); }
